  • Personal Safety Tips and Precautions: Prioritizing personal safety and taking precautions is essential to help reduce the risk of becoming a victim of crime. These actions include being aware of your surroundings, avoiding walking alone at night in poorly lit areas, and locking doors and windows in your home and vehicle. These precautions, when followed, can significantly reduce the risk of becoming a victim of crime.

    Practical tips include keeping valuables out of sight, informing someone of your plans, and being cautious when meeting strangers. In addition, it's wise to install home security systems, security cameras, and good lighting. Reporting any suspicious activity to the police is also critical. These precautions not only enhance personal safety but also contribute to a safer environment for everyone in the community.

  • Reporting Suspicious Activity to the Authorities: Reporting suspicious activity to the authorities is a vital step in maintaining community safety. It gives law enforcement valuable information that can help prevent crimes and solve cases. It encourages people to trust and engage with the police, creating a more proactive and collaborative community.

    If you notice anything unusual, such as a person loitering, a vehicle parked suspiciously, or signs of possible criminal activity, report it immediately. Contact the Springfield Police Department or use the city's non-emergency line. Providing as much detail as possible, such as descriptions of people and vehicles, the location, and what you witnessed, will aid law enforcement. By reporting suspicious activity, you contribute to a safer community and assist police in their efforts to protect our city.
